Transaction 42d6991d2135efe8fae855ed039d4a3683313b4dc4f48778dccd6e711f63531a
1 Input
1 Output
-
42d6991d2135efe8fae855ed039d4a3683313b4dc4f48778dccd6e711f63531a:0
- value
- 1085236
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d516c7075b2eb0d5ae7ec99758e1d39ecf64dfa OP_EQUAL
- address
- 38jqVj15vftfrTQxt27znSYyeZiWmBgviK